Additionally, he reportedly violated his probation from his 2008 arrest for guns and drugs by booking out-of-state shows and changing his number without alerting his probation officer as well as his social media presence where he spoke ill of his probation officer and prosecutor on Twitter and posed with a gun on his Instagram. He was booked in Pennsylvania, the first day of his incarceration being July 11. He had a show in Philadelphia planned for that day. The timing of his arrest comes just as Meek Mill announced a September release for his second album, Dreams Worth More Than Money, and a string of shows, which have since been canceled.
